@JsonDeserialize(builder = PaymentOrder.Builder::class)
@NoAutoDetect
class PaymentOrder
private constructor(
    private val id: JsonField,
    private val object_: JsonField,
    private val liveMode: JsonField,
    private val createdAt: JsonField,
    private val updatedAt: JsonField,
    private val type: JsonField,
    private val subtype: JsonField,
    private val amount: JsonField,
    private val direction: JsonField,
    private val priority: JsonField,
    private val originatingAccountId: JsonField,
    private val receivingAccountId: JsonField,
    private val accounting: JsonField,
    private val accountingCategoryId: JsonField,
    private val accountingLedgerClassId: JsonField,
    private val currency: JsonField,
    private val effectiveDate: JsonField,
    private val description: JsonField,
    private val statementDescriptor: JsonField,
    private val remittanceInformation: JsonField,
    private val processAfter: JsonField,
    private val purpose: JsonField,
    private val metadata: JsonField,
    private val chargeBearer: JsonField,
    private val foreignExchangeIndicator: JsonField,
    private val foreignExchangeContract: JsonField,
    private val nsfProtected: JsonField,
    private val originatingPartyName: JsonField,
    private val ultimateOriginatingPartyName: JsonField,
    private val ultimateOriginatingPartyIdentifier: JsonField,
    private val ultimateReceivingPartyName: JsonField,
    private val ultimateReceivingPartyIdentifier: JsonField,
    private val sendRemittanceAdvice: JsonField,
    private val expiresAt: JsonField,
    private val status: JsonField,
    private val receivingAccountType: JsonField,
    private val ultimateOriginatingAccount: JsonField,
    private val ultimateOriginatingAccountId: JsonField,
    private val ultimateOriginatingAccountType: JsonField,
    private val counterpartyId: JsonField,
    private val transactionIds: JsonField>,
    private val ledgerTransactionId: JsonField,
    private val currentReturn: JsonField,
    private val transactionMonitoringEnabled: JsonField,
    private val complianceRuleMetadata: JsonField,
    private val referenceNumbers: JsonField>,
    private val vendorFailureReason: JsonField,
    private val decisionId: JsonField,
    private val foreignExchangeRate: JsonField,
    private val vendorAttributes: JsonValue,
    private val additionalProperties: Map,
) {

    private var validated: Boolean = false

    fun id(): String = id.getRequired("id")

    fun object_(): String = object_.getRequired("object")

    /**
     * This field will be true if this object exists in the live environment or false if it exists
     * in the test environment.
     */
    fun liveMode(): Boolean = liveMode.getRequired("live_mode")

    fun createdAt(): OffsetDateTime = createdAt.getRequired("created_at")

    fun updatedAt(): OffsetDateTime = updatedAt.getRequired("updated_at")

    /**
     * One of `ach`, `se_bankgirot`, `eft`, `wire`, `check`, `sen`, `book`, `rtp`, `sepa`, `bacs`,
     * `au_becs`, `interac`, `neft`, `nics`, `nz_national_clearing_code`, `sic`, `signet`,
     * `provexchange`, `zengin`.
     */
    fun type(): PaymentOrderType = type.getRequired("type")

    /**
     * An additional layer of classification for the type of payment order you are doing. This field
     * is only used for `ach` payment orders currently. For `ach` payment orders, the `subtype`
     * represents the SEC code. We currently support `CCD`, `PPD`, `IAT`, `CTX`, `WEB`, `CIE`, and
     * `TEL`.
     */
    fun subtype(): PaymentOrderSubtype? = subtype.getNullable("subtype")

    /**
     * Value in specified currency's smallest unit. e.g. $10 would be represented as 1000 (cents).
     * For RTP, the maximum amount allowed by the network is $100,000.
     */
    fun amount(): Long = amount.getRequired("amount")

    /**
     * One of `credit`, `debit`. Describes the direction money is flowing in the transaction. A
     * `credit` moves money from your account to someone else's. A `debit` pulls money from someone
     * else's account to your own. Note that wire, rtp, and check payments will always be `credit`.
     */
    fun direction(): Direction = direction.getRequired("direction")

    /**
     * Either `normal` or `high`. For ACH and EFT payments, `high` represents a same-day ACH or EFT
     * transfer, respectively. For check payments, `high` can mean an overnight check rather than
     * standard mail.
     */
    fun priority(): Priority = priority.getRequired("priority")

    /** The ID of one of your organization's internal accounts. */
    fun originatingAccountId(): String = originatingAccountId.getRequired("originating_account_id")

    /** The receiving account ID. Can be an `external_account` or `internal_account`. */
    fun receivingAccountId(): String = receivingAccountId.getRequired("receiving_account_id")

    fun accounting(): Accounting = accounting.getRequired("accounting")

    /**
     * The ID of one of your accounting categories. Note that these will only be accessible if your
     * accounting system has been connected.
     */
    fun accountingCategoryId(): String? = accountingCategoryId.getNullable("accounting_category_id")

    /**
     * The ID of one of your accounting ledger classes. Note that these will only be accessible if
     * your accounting system has been connected.
     */
    fun accountingLedgerClassId(): String? =
        accountingLedgerClassId.getNullable("accounting_ledger_class_id")

    /** Defaults to the currency of the originating account. */
    fun currency(): Currency = currency.getRequired("currency")

    /**
     * Date transactions are to be posted to the participants' account. Defaults to the current
     * business day or the next business day if the current day is a bank holiday or weekend.
     * Format: yyyy-mm-dd.
     */
    fun effectiveDate(): LocalDate = effectiveDate.getRequired("effective_date")

    /** An optional description for internal use. */
    fun description(): String? = description.getNullable("description")

    /**
     * An optional descriptor which will appear in the receiver's statement. For `check` payments
     * this field will be used as the memo line. For `ach` the maximum length is 10 characters. Note
     * that for ACH payments, the name on your bank account will be included automatically by the
     * bank, so you can use the characters for other useful information. For `eft` the maximum
     * length is 15 characters.
     */
    fun statementDescriptor(): String? = statementDescriptor.getNullable("statement_descriptor")

    /**
     * For `ach`, this field will be passed through on an addenda record. For `wire` payments the
     * field will be passed through as the "Originator to Beneficiary Information", also known as
     * OBI or Fedwire tag 6000.
     */
    fun remittanceInformation(): String? =
        remittanceInformation.getNullable("remittance_information")

    /**
     * If present, Modern Treasury will not process the payment until after this time. If
     * `process_after` is past the cutoff for `effective_date`, `process_after` will take precedence
     * and `effective_date` will automatically update to reflect the earliest possible sending date
     * after `process_after`. Format is ISO8601 timestamp.
     */
    fun processAfter(): OffsetDateTime? = processAfter.getNullable("process_after")

    /**
     * For `wire`, this is usually the purpose which is transmitted via the "InstrForDbtrAgt" field
     * in the ISO20022 file. For `eft`, this field is the 3 digit CPA Code that will be attached to
     * the payment.
     */
    fun purpose(): String? = purpose.getNullable("purpose")

    /** Additional data represented as key-value pairs. Both the key and value must be strings. */
    fun metadata(): Metadata = metadata.getRequired("metadata")

    /**
     * The party that will pay the fees for the payment order. Only applies to wire payment orders.
     * Can be one of shared, sender, or receiver, which correspond respectively with the SWIFT 71A
     * values `SHA`, `OUR`, `BEN`.
     */
    fun chargeBearer(): ChargeBearer? = chargeBearer.getNullable("charge_bearer")

    /**
     * Indicates the type of FX transfer to initiate, can be either `variable_to_fixed`,
     * `fixed_to_variable`, or `null` if the payment order currency matches the originating account
     * currency.
     */
    fun foreignExchangeIndicator(): ForeignExchangeIndicator? =
        foreignExchangeIndicator.getNullable("foreign_exchange_indicator")

    /**
     * If present, indicates a specific foreign exchange contract number that has been generated by
     * your financial institution.
     */
    fun foreignExchangeContract(): String? =
        foreignExchangeContract.getNullable("foreign_exchange_contract")

    /**
     * A boolean to determine if NSF Protection is enabled for this payment order. Note that this
     * setting must also be turned on in your organization settings page.
     */
    fun nsfProtected(): Boolean = nsfProtected.getRequired("nsf_protected")

    /**
     * If present, this will replace your default company name on receiver's bank statement. This
     * field can only be used for ACH payments currently. For ACH, only the first 16 characters of
     * this string will be used. Any additional characters will be truncated.
     */
    fun originatingPartyName(): String? = originatingPartyName.getNullable("originating_party_name")

    /** Name of the ultimate originator of the payment order. */
    fun ultimateOriginatingPartyName(): String? =
        ultimateOriginatingPartyName.getNullable("ultimate_originating_party_name")

    /** Identifier of the ultimate originator of the payment order. */
    fun ultimateOriginatingPartyIdentifier(): String? =
        ultimateOriginatingPartyIdentifier.getNullable("ultimate_originating_party_identifier")

    fun ultimateReceivingPartyName(): String? =
        ultimateReceivingPartyName.getNullable("ultimate_receiving_party_name")

    fun ultimateReceivingPartyIdentifier(): String? =
        ultimateReceivingPartyIdentifier.getNullable("ultimate_receiving_party_identifier")

    /**
     * Send an email to the counterparty when the payment order is sent to the bank. If `null`,
     * `send_remittance_advice` on the Counterparty is used.
     */
    fun sendRemittanceAdvice(): Boolean? =
        sendRemittanceAdvice.getNullable("send_remittance_advice")

    /** RFP payments require an expires_at. This value must be past the effective_date. */
    fun expiresAt(): OffsetDateTime? = expiresAt.getNullable("expires_at")

    /** The current status of the payment order. */
    fun status(): Status = status.getRequired("status")

    fun receivingAccountType(): ReceivingAccountType =
        receivingAccountType.getRequired("receiving_account_type")

    /**
     * The account to which the originating of this payment should be attributed to. Can be a
     * `virtual_account` or `internal_account`.
     */
    fun ultimateOriginatingAccount(): UltimateOriginatingAccount? =
        ultimateOriginatingAccount.getNullable("ultimate_originating_account")

    /** The ultimate originating account ID. Can be a `virtual_account` or `internal_account`. */
    fun ultimateOriginatingAccountId(): String? =
        ultimateOriginatingAccountId.getNullable("ultimate_originating_account_id")

    fun ultimateOriginatingAccountType(): UltimateOriginatingAccountType? =
        ultimateOriginatingAccountType.getNullable("ultimate_originating_account_type")

    /**
     * If the payment order is tied to a specific Counterparty, their id will appear, otherwise
     * `null`.
     */
    fun counterpartyId(): String? = counterpartyId.getNullable("counterparty_id")

    /**
     * The IDs of all the transactions associated to this payment order. Usually, you will only have
     * a single transaction ID. However, if a payment order initially results in a Return, but gets
     * redrafted and is later successfully completed, it can have many transactions.
     */
    fun transactionIds(): List = transactionIds.getRequired("transaction_ids")

    /** The ID of the ledger transaction linked to the payment order. */
    fun ledgerTransactionId(): String? = ledgerTransactionId.getNullable("ledger_transaction_id")

    /** If the payment order's status is `returned`, this will include the return object's data. */
    fun currentReturn(): ReturnObject? = currentReturn.getNullable("current_return")

    /** A flag that determines whether a payment order should go through transaction monitoring. */
    fun transactionMonitoringEnabled(): Boolean =
        transactionMonitoringEnabled.getRequired("transaction_monitoring_enabled")

    /**
     * Custom key-value pair for usage in compliance rules. Please contact support before making
     * changes to this field.
     */
    fun complianceRuleMetadata(): ComplianceRuleMetadata? =
        complianceRuleMetadata.getNullable("compliance_rule_metadata")

    fun referenceNumbers(): List =
        referenceNumbers.getRequired("reference_numbers")

    /**
     * This field will be populated if a vendor failure occurs. Logic shouldn't be built on its
     * value as it is free-form.
     */
    fun vendorFailureReason(): String? = vendorFailureReason.getNullable("vendor_failure_reason")

    /**
     * The ID of the compliance decision for the payment order, if transaction monitoring is
     * enabled.
     */
    fun decisionId(): String? = decisionId.getNullable("decision_id")

    /** Associated serialized foreign exchange rate information. */
    fun foreignExchangeRate(): ForeignExchangeRate? =
        foreignExchangeRate.getNullable("foreign_exchange_rate")
